Description du Produit

Alta Alcurnia Rosé wine is a blend of three varieties with a dominance of the 86% de Carménère, with a 7% Cabernet Sauvignon and a 7% Petit Verdot ou. The production of this wine is the result of teamwork, highlighted by the entrepreneurial drive of the marriage of Malgorzata and Tomasz Wawruch assessed by the skill of professionals in viticulture and oenology, as winemakers Philippo Pszczólkowski and Ricardo Pérez-Cruz. Ils sont accompagnés par l'effort et la détermination des agriculteurs Colchagua Valley. The Rosé wine is produced with the skin contact method. Black skinned grapes: Carménère, Cabernet Sauvignon and Petit Verdot are crushed and the skins are allowed to remain in contact with the juice for a short period of one night at low temperature (10°C). Next, the juice is cleaned up and let for cold fermentation.
